BUDE Town boss Steve Hackett is targeting ‘experienced players’ as they look to kick on in SWPL Premier West.

Hackett took over the Seasiders last summer having been manager of the reserves, and despite having to assemble a completely new squad, many of whom were with him in St Piran League Division Three East, they finished 14th in the 16-team division.

Such is the desire to improve at Broadclose Park, players have been put their through paces by local personal trainer Eddie Marbell, while five pre-season games have been announced, all against North Devon-based opposition.

They start with a trip to SWPL Premier East outfit Torrington on Saturday, July 5 before welcoming Devon League outfit Fremington on July 10.

A second Thursday night encounter at home sees Ilfracombe Town visit a week later.

The Bluebirds were in the Western League Premier Division last term and should provide a stern test.

Bude are back on their travels on July 26 as they head to Torridge Cup winners Torridgeside, before they round off their preparations with a visit from Appledore on Wednesday, July 30.

Both Saturday games are set for 2pm with the evening fixtures set for a 7.30pm start.

Hackett told the Post: “We are looking to retain all of our current players and make some more signings to strengthen the squad and give us more competition for places.

“We are especially looking for a few more older, more experienced players to bolster the group.

“We’ve got five fixtures booked in to get us ready, work is underway on the playing surface and we’re looking forward to trying to push on again.”

The club have also announced a testimonial for club legend Steve Box on Saturday, July 19.

The match, which will include some of his former team-mates and the current squad, is set for a 5.30pm kick-off.
